Feedback (Automatic) control

is an engineering discipline. As such, its progress is closely tied to the practical problems that needed to be solved during any phase of human history. The key developments in the history of mankind that affected the progress of feedback control were:
1-The Water Clocks of the Greeks and Arabs.
2-The Industrial Revolution. 
3-Age of Computer and programmable devices
